Abstract
The utility model discloses a waterproof roll tensile property test fixture which comprises a connection arm, a lower clamp block, an upper clamp block and a connection bolt, wherein the lower clamp block is fixedly connected with the connection arm; the upper clamp block is movably arranged on the lower clamp block through the connection bolt; the upper clamp block is parallel to the lower clamp block; the connection arm is provided with an oblique end; and one end of the oblique end is connected with the lower clamp block, the other end of the oblique end is connected with the connection arm, and the end connected with the lower clamp block is lower than the end connected with the connection arm. The waterproof roll tensile property test fixture disclosed by the utility model ensures load application along the axis so that a sample and the fixture are on the same axis; concentrated load generated by the fixture is avoided, and the stability and the uniformity of the applied load are guaranteed; and the sample is effectively fixed, the slip of the sample in the fixture does not exceed the limit value, and the influence on the accuracy of the test result is lowered.

Background technology
The check of the tensile property of waterproof roll, is mainly the two ends by using fixture clamping waterproof roll sample, then uses pulling force equipment to carry out extension test.In prior art, the test fixture of the tensile property of waterproof roll is difficult to guarantee along axis load application, cannot guarantees that sample and fixture are on same axis; Easily there is load in fixture, the problem that institute's load application is unstable, inhomogeneous; Cannot effectively fix sample, the slippage of sample in fixture had a strong impact on the accuracy of test result.

Above-mentioned waterproof roll tensile property test fixture is used steel plate entirety to process, and the intensity of selected steel is not less than Q345 steel.Above fixture possesses enough rigidity, not yielding, and can well contact with test specimen and without slippage rotate, each accessory all carries out antirust processing.
